Significant South America Primary Battery Market Industry Milestones
- November 2022: Argentina commences operations at its first lithium battery plant in La Plata, supported by UNLP, Y-TEC, and the National Scientific and Technical Research Council. This development significantly boosts domestic lithium-ion battery production, potentially impacting the primary battery market in the long term by creating a local competitor for certain applications.
- December 2022: Argentina's Y-TEC YPF announces plans for a lithium battery manufacturing plant in Catamarca, focusing on cell production, lithium-ion batteries, and active materials. This further strengthens Argentina's position in the battery value chain and could lead to future competition with existing primary battery suppliers.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
December 2022: Argentina's state-run Y-TEC YPF announced its plans to install a lithium battery manufacturing plant in the Catamarca. According to the deal signed, the company will produce cells, lithium-ion batteries, and active materials to add to the current work by the provincial mining company CAMYEN in Fiambal.
